#590f1d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#590f1d is composed of 34.9% red, 5.9% green and 11.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 83.1% magenta, 67.4% yellow and 65.1% black. It has a hue angle of 348.6 degrees, a saturation of 71.2% and a lightness of 20.4%. #590f1d color hex could be obtained by blending #b21e3a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

#590f1d color description : Very dark red.

#590f1d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#590f1d has RGB values of R:89, G:15, B:29 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.83, Y:0.67, K:0.65. Its decimal value is 5836573.

Shades and Tints of #590f1d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050102 is the darkest color, while #fdf3f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#590f1d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#353333 is the less saturated color, while #650316 is the most saturated one.
